Dear Nikolay,
we have started to work on producing the derivatives with respect to parameters. We are planing to create a new function, that will return a 3-dimensional array, by equation, variable and parameter. You could then select one parameter and squeeze the array in the parameter dimension to obtain a matrix of Jacobian derivatives with respect to a given parameter. Do you see any problem with this implementation? We should be able to provide in about two weeks.
